How much does it cost to rent an apartment in MIT?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
MIT Studio Apartments | $3,484 | $2,815 | $10,000+ |
MIT 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,111 | $1,300 | $10,000+ |
MIT 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,285 | $3,000 | $10,000+ |
MIT 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,076 | $1,200 | $10,000+ |
MIT 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,692 | $1,996 | $7,600 |

Quick Rent Budget Calculator
How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
